Description

17 Salisbury Street is a three-storey building with a two-window front, dating from after 1731. It features typical brickwork and sash windows, along with a brick dentil eaves cornice. The ground floor is an open fishmonger's shop. This building is part of a group with Nos 9 to 19 (odd).
